Looks perfectly normal to me

those spiky lines in the beginning are very common and nothing to worry about (moreover: it is also a binning issue, first 9 bases is per base, after that they are 'grouped' per 5 , if you want you can disable this behaviour , --no_group or such?)

I would , personally, be more worried about all other metrics being 'green' ... that is not so common

Keep in mind that FastQC is a tool that has been around for quite a while and is actually not designed to accurately work with the modern day sequencing output(s)

Positional/sequence bias is likely present (in spite of kits claiming its absence) and that is what you are likely seeing at the beginning of reads. Sounds like you have already read this blog --> https://sequencing.qcfail.com/articles/positional-sequence-bias-in-random-primed-libraries/ .

Plot is suggesting a AT rich library of some sort. What kind of sequencing is this? Perhaps your organism has AT rich transcriptome, this is a poly-A enriched library or a total RNAseq library (rRNA present in large amounts).
